| Skiddz Veteran | I've been told that the RV camping and night flying "...should not be a problem.". Sounds like the base just needs to run the request through the "food chain" and we should be good to go.For now, plan on everything being a "go" and we'll adjust if necessary.Just in case you need more detail:Flying Site:1. The MRCF field is located on an active military reserve and is subject to all of the base rules and regulations. 2. Smoking, alcohol consumption and illegal drug use are strictly prohibited at all times on the base. This is not negotiable! 3. The flying field is situated within a nature preserve and all animals and vegetation on the site are protected. 4. Access to undeveloped areas is prohibited. Please do not “hike” out into the brushed areas. Large rattlesnakes are living around our field and we don’t want anyone getting bitten. 5. Do not disturb the wildlife. If you encounter a snake or other animal, back away and leave it alone. 6. All other MRCF club rules will be in effect. Those rules can be found at: http://www.miramarrcflyers.com/inde...id=43&Itemid=69Site Access: 1. The Miramar RC Flyers field is only accessible by way of a locked gate. Entry and exit are strictly controlled and everyone must be escorted to and from the field by a club member. 2. The entry gate will be open from 0700 until 1000 each morning of the event and then periodically throughout the day and again in the evening for those who wish to go get some dinner off-site. 3. If you arrive and the gate is locked, dial the number on the white board at the gate and tell the person that answers you’ve come for the fun fly. Someone will be sent down to let you in. 4. If you need to leave the field you will need to get a club member to escort you to the gate. Please be thoughtful of the club.AMA Regulations: 1. The AMA National Model Aircraft Safety Code will be strictly enforced. 2. Valid AMA cards are *REQUIRED* for ALL pilots and must be shown at pilot registry. 3. Frequency control is in effect for anyone operating in the 72MHz bands. All 72 MHz band pilots will be required to place their AMA card in the appropriate frequency slot in the channel board and display the corresponding frequency pin in a visible location.Flight Line: 1. All pilots *MUST* have a spotter. 2. The spotter is responsible for informing the pilot of “traffic” encroaching upon his defined airspace. 3. *ONE* photographer may stand with the pilot/spotter with the pilot’s permission. 4. No one is permitted past the pit fence other than the pilot, spotter and photographer as stated above. 5. Pilots waiting for a flight station may stage their aircraft and support gear in the pit area while they wait. 6. All spectators will be prohibited from entering the zone between the pits and the flight stations.Night Flying: This is a first for the Miramar RC Flyers club and as such there will be limitations: 1. All helicopters must be self-illuminated. Sorry, no spotlight flying. Maybe next time. 2. There will be pilot station available and only *ONE* helicopter will be allowed in the air at a time.Turbine Aircraft: 1. All Turbine operators will be required to produce a current AMA turbine waiver at registration 2. All turbine operations will be subject to the AMA's Turbine Safety Regulations which can be found at: http://www.modelaircraft.org/PDF-files/510-A.pdf 3. All Turbine operations are subject to National Weather Service Fire Weather Planning Forecasts (FWZ), National Weather Service Red Flag Warnings and Fire Weather Watches for California. Red Flag = no fly. No exceptions.Camping: 1. There will be limited space available for overnight camping in RVs or campers - there will be no tent camping allowed. 2. Please contact Mark Lukens or Kevin Spousta in advance of the event to check on availability. 3. The field will be open for camper arrivals starting Friday, July 13th after 5pm. 4. Club members will be on site to help with positioning your rig. 5. All RVs must be gone by 4:30 PM on Sunday the 14th. 6. There are no hookups and no potable water available. Fill up before you show up. 7. No dumping of any RV tanks – not even fresh water. Find a dump station on your way home. 8. Absolutely *NO* open fires. That includes gas barbecues. The club has a permit for its gas grill and its use will be available for overnight guests. Please provide your own BBQ tools. 9. The club has no trash pickup services so please police your own areas and take your own trash with you when you go. 10. Generator use is ok provided your generator is equipped with a spark arrestor and muffler. All generators must be shut down at 11:00pm.Hotels: There are two hotels across the freeway from the field -1. Holiday Inn (http://www.holidayinn.com/hotels/us...nmm/hoteldetail) 2. Best Western Plus. (http://www.bestwesternmiramar.com/)Remember, we are all guests of the US Marine Corp while at the field. Please act accordingly.If you have any questions about the event or the rules please contact:Mark Lukens – Contest Director - malukens AT yahoo DOT com Kevin Spousta – Event Coordinator – skiddz AT roadrunner DOT com A helicopter is 10,000 parts spinning rapidly around an oil leak. | ||
